Buttermilk Substitute for Cooking

The buttermilk substitute that my Mom taught me many years ago has worked well in every recipe that I have used it in. As it is cheaper than buying some at the store we tend to use it more often. Take 1 cup of milk and add 1Tablespoon of lemon juice to it. Stir it around and allow to sit for 15 minutes.
